A Hybrid Domain Image Encryption Algorithm Based on Improved Henon Map

被引:37
作者
Chen, Yong [1 ]
Xie, Shucui [1 ,2 ]
Zhang, Jianzhong [3 ]
机构
[1] Xian Univ Posts & Telecommun, Sch Commun & Informat Engn, Xian 710121, Peoples R China
[2] Xian Univ Posts & Telecommun, Sch Sci, Xian 710121, Peoples R China
[3] Shaanxi Normal Univ, Sch Math & Stat, Xian 710119, Peoples R China
关键词
image encryption; improved Henon map; integer wavelet transform; double sandwich structure; SHA-512; LYAPUNOV EXPONENTS; SCHEME; CHAOS; WAVELET; PERMUTATION; SYSTEM;
D O I
10.3390/e24020287
中图分类号
O4 [物理学];
学科分类号
0702 ;
摘要
A hybrid domain image encryption algorithm is developed by integrating with improved Henon map, integer wavelet transform (IWT), bit-plane decomposition, and deoxyribonucleic acid (DNA) sequence operations. First, we improve the classical two-dimensional Henon map. The improved Henon map is called 2D-ICHM, and its chaotic performance is analyzed. Compared with some existing chaotic maps, 2D-ICHM has larger parameter space, continuous chaotic range, and more complex dynamic behavior. Second, an image encryption structure based on diffusion-scrambling-diffusion and spatial domain-frequency domain-spatial domain is proposed, which we call the double sandwich structure. In the encryption process, the diffusion and scrambling operations are performed in the spatial and frequency domains, respectively. In addition, initial values and system parameters of the 2D-ICHM are obtained by the secure hash algorithm-512 (SHA-512) hash value of the plain image and the given parameters. Consequently, the proposed algorithm is highly sensitive to plain images. Finally, simulation experiments and security analysis show that the proposed algorithm has a high level of security and strong robustness to various cryptanalytic attacks.
引用
收藏
页数:28
相关论文
共 60 条
[1]   A hybrid genetic algorithm and chaotic function model for image encryption [J].
Abdullah, Abdul Hanan ;
Enayatifar, Rasul ;
Lee, Malrey .
AEU-INTERNATIONAL JOURNAL OF ELECTRONICS AND COMMUNICATIONS, 2012, 66 (10) :806-816
[2]   Some basic cryptographic requirements for chaos-based cryptosystems [J].
Alvarez, Gonzalo ;
Li, Shujun .
INTERNATIONAL JOURNAL OF BIFURCATION AND CHAOS, 2006, 16 (08) :2129-2151
[3]   Image Compression and Encryption Combining Autoencoder and Chaotic Logistic Map [J].
Ameen Suhail, K. M. ;
Sankar, Syam .
IRANIAN JOURNAL OF SCIENCE AND TECHNOLOGY TRANSACTION A-SCIENCE, 2020, 44 (04) :1091-1100
[4]   A robust medical image encryption in dual domain: chaos-DNA-IWT combined approach [J].
Banu, Aashiq S. ;
Amirtharajan, Rengarajan .
MEDICAL & BIOLOGICAL ENGINEERING & COMPUTING, 2020, 58 (07) :1445-1458
[5]   Initials-Boosted Coexisting Chaos in a 2-D Sine Map and Its Hardware Implementation [J].
Bao, Han ;
Hua, Zhongyun ;
Wang, Ning ;
Zhu, Lei ;
Chen, Mo ;
Bao, Bocheng .
IEEE TRANSACTIONS ON INDUSTRIAL INFORMATICS, 2021, 17 (02) :1132-1140
[6]   Chaos-based partial image encryption scheme based on linear fractional and lifting wavelet transforms [J].
Belazi, Akram ;
El-Latif, Ahmed A. Abd ;
Diaconu, Adrian-Viorel ;
Rhouma, Rhouma ;
Belghith, Safya .
OPTICS AND LASERS IN ENGINEERING, 2017, 88 :37-50
[7]   A novel chaos based optical image encryption using fractional Fourier transform and DNA sequence operation [J].
Ben Farah, M. A. ;
Guesmi, R. ;
Kachouri, A. ;
Samet, M. .
OPTICS AND LASER TECHNOLOGY, 2020, 121
[8]   A robust compressed sensing image encryption algorithm based on GAN and CNN [J].
Chai, Xiuli ;
Tian, Ye ;
Gan, Zhihua ;
Lu, Yang ;
Wu, Xiang-Jun ;
Long, Guoqiang .
JOURNAL OF MODERN OPTICS, 2022, 69 (02) :103-120
[9]   A symmetric image encryption scheme based on 3D chaotic cat maps [J].
Chen, GR ;
Mao, YB ;
Chui, CK .
CHAOS SOLITONS & FRACTALS, 2004, 21 (03) :749-761
[10]  
Chen H., 2006, P 2005 IEEE ENG MED, P6360